HMCT.L vs. HMCH.L
Compare and contrast key facts about HSBC MSCI CHINA A UCITS ETF (HMCT.L) and HSBC MSCI China UCITS ETF (HMCH.L).
HMCT.L and HMCH.L are both exchange-traded funds (ETFs), meaning they are traded on stock exchanges and can be bought and sold throughout the day. HMCT.L is a passively managed fund by HSBC that tracks the performance of the MSCI China A Onshore NR CNY. It was launched on Jul 27, 2018. HMCH.L is a passively managed fund by HSBC that tracks the performance of the MSCI China NR USD. It was launched on Jan 26, 2011. Both HMCT.L and HMCH.L are passive ETFs, meaning that they are not actively managed but aim to replicate the performance of the underlying index as closely as possible.

Correlation
The correlation between HMCT.L and HMCH.L is 0.77,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

Dividends
HMCT.L vs. HMCH.L - Dividend Comparison
HMCT.L's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 2.17%, more than HMCH.L's 2.05% yield.
TTM |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
HMCT.L HSBC MSCI CHINA A UCITS ETF | 2.17% | 2.03% | 2.16% | 1.69% | 1.12% | 0.84% | 1.71% |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.00% | 0.00% |
HMCH.L HSBC MSCI China UCITS ETF | 2.05% | 2.17% | 2.12% | 1.85% | 1.28% | 0.92% | 1.65% | 1.36% | 0.78% | 1.89% | 2.84% | 1.68% |
